Public call for an analysis of the norms and practices of promotion to a position at universities

The Network of Academic Solidarity and Engagement (MASA) refers public call for an analysis of the norms and practices of promotion in the universities of the Republic of Serbia. It is necessary for the analysis to include the regulations related to the standards and the procedure of selection for a title at the three largest universities in Serbia: the University of Belgrade, the University of Novi Sad and the University of Niš. The analysis should be carried out at the university level, focusing on one faculty of choice from 4 scientific fields at each university (natural-mathematical, medical, technical-technological and social-humanistic). The analysis should also include informative interviews with the representatives of the faculties involved in the analysis, in order to gain a complete insight into the shortcomings of the selection process.

The aforementioned analysis should serve as a basis for understanding the problems in the process of advancement at faculties in the Republic of Serbia, first of all pointing out more concretely the norms and practices that enable discrimination, nepotism and the lack of clear evaluation criteria of applied candidates or their violation.

The call is intended first young researchers and doctoral students who can help us in formulating recommendations for the adequate arrangement of the selection process for the position, but other researchers can also answer the invitation. The total budget for this activity is 70,000 RSD gross.

Public call for an analysis of accreditation norms and practices

The Network of Academic Solidarity and Engagement (MASA) refers public call for an analysis of the norms and practices of accreditation of higher education institutions and study programs in the Republic of Serbia. It is necessary for the analysis to include regulations related to the standards and accreditation procedure of higher education institutions and study processes, existing analyzes and recommendations, and informative discussions with representatives of the National Accreditation Body and users of accreditation (faculties), in order to gain a complete insight into the shortcomings of the accreditation process .

The aforementioned analysis should serve as a basis for understanding the problems in the accreditation process in the Republic of Serbia, primarily the impossibility of ensuring the independence of accreditation decisions by the National Body for Accreditation and Quality Control in Higher Education of Serbia (NAT), which is why this body recently lost the status of a full member of the European Association for Quality Assurance in Higher Education (ENQA).

The invitation is intended primarily young researchers and doctoral students who can help us in formulating recommendations for the adequate organization of the accreditation process, but other researchers can also respond to the invitation. The total budget for this activity is 50,000 RSD gross.

MPNTR's response regarding the open letter from Masa

The Ministry of Education, Science and Technological Development sent a response to open letter from Mass on the occasion of the "Third call for talented young researchers - students of doctoral academic studies for inclusion in scientific research work in accredited scientific research organizations".

You can download the answer at the following LINK.

The Network of Academic Solidarity and Engagement requested the reformulation of two conditions of this call:

1. That the right to submit an application belongs to young researchers who are enrolled in the first year of doctoral academic studies for the academic year 2019/2020;
2. That he is at most 30 years old or that he was born in 1989 or earlier.

Thus, young researchers who are full-time doctoral students or who have defended their doctorate within the last seven years, in accordance with good European practices, have the right to submit an application.
